Evaluating the Ghanaian Skincare Technology Landscape

The demand for non-invasive, permanent aesthetic treatments in West Africa, particularly in economic centers such as Accra, Kumasi, and Takoradi, is undergoing an exponential shift. Historically, hair removal methods in Ghana relied on traditional shaving, waxing, and chemical depilatory creams. However, these methods frequently lead to adverse dermatological outcomes on high-melanin skin, including severe pseudofolliculitis barbae (razor bumps), post-inflammatory hyperpigmentation (PIH), and epidermal scarring.

As disposable incomes rise and urbanization accelerates, Ghanaian consumers are increasingly seeking modern, clinic-grade aesthetic solutions for home and local salon use. Despite this surge, a fundamental safety barrier exists: unregulated photothermal (IPL) devices can cause permanent damage to high-melanin skin without proper optical calibration and intelligent skin sensor technology. Why Intelligent Skin Sensing is Non-Negotiable

High-melanin skin types contain higher concentrations of eumelanin, which naturally absorbs broad-spectrum light. Standard IPL devices discharge uniform energy that targets both hair-shaft melanin and epidermal melanin indiscriminately, causing burns. Smart sensors dynamically calculate local skin pigmentation levels before and during every single flash, auto-adjusting the Joule output to sub-critical thresholds that target the follicle without overheating the epidermis.

Technical Blueprint: Physics of IPL on High-Melanin Skin (Fitzpatrick V-VI)

Standard aesthetic devices operate by emitting broad-spectrum light (typically 500nm to 1200nm). Eumelanin's absorption spectrum decreases as wavelength increases. Therefore, to ensure clinical safety on darker skin tones prevalent in Ghana, the IPL emission spectrum must be shifted toward longer wavelengths (e.g., filtering out wavelengths below 600nm or 650nm) to minimize epidermal absorption while maximizing energy delivery to the deeper hair follicle matrix.

Wavelength Tuning & Optical Filters

Our systems incorporate interchangeable sapphire filters (640nm, 690nm, and up to 755nm). By filtering out high-energy shorter wavelengths, we significantly reduce photothermal action in the basal layer of the skin, offering safe hair removal configurations specifically tailored for Ghana.

Real-Time Pigment Feedback Loops

An integrated bio-photonic sensor scans the skin at 100 Hz frequency. If the sensor detects a high density of melanin, the device's internal CPU instantly modifies the pulse duration, utilizing multi-pulse technology to allow the epidermis to cool between micro-flashes.

Contact Sapphire Cooling Integration

By keeping the treatment window continuously cooled to between 5°C and 10°C, we temporarily desensitize local nerve endings and restrict blood flow, preventing thermal accumulation in the upper skin layers during therapeutic light emission.

Custom Clearance and FDA/GSA Compliance

Devices entering Ghana must comply with the Ghana Standards Authority (GSA) and the Ghana Food and Drugs Authority (FDA) guidelines for personal care electronics. We support importers by providing full technical dossiers, CE/RoHS test reports, and electrical safety certificates. This prevents port clearance delays at the Tema Harbour or Kotoka International Airport (ACC).

Localization of Hardware and Packaging

Ghanaian standard electrical outlets utilize the Type G plug configuration (British Standard BS 1363, 230V/50Hz). Our manufacturing facility pre-configures all shipments destined for West Africa with molded Type G cords, eliminating the need for unsafe third-party adapters. User manuals and UI operating software are fully localized in standard English, complete with clear Fitzpatrick Skin Type guides.

Is IPL hair removal safe for dark skin (Fitzpatrick Skin Type V and VI) common in Ghana?
Yes, but only when utilizing devices equipped with active skin tone sensors and customized long-wavelength filters (above 640nm). High-melanin skin absorbs light energy rapidly; standard IPLs risk causing burns. Our devices with smart sensor technology monitor local melanin index levels and adjust output energy dynamically, ensuring the epidermis remains safe during treatment.

Do you supply the appropriate power plug for Ghana's electrical grid?
Yes. All shipments packaged for Ghana are manufactured with Type G plugs (British Standard BS 1363), matching the local standard electrical outlet configuration. The internal power supply is rated for 100V–240V and 50Hz/60Hz to handle local voltage fluctuations.
